Chapter 1: Energy Balance and Weight Loss
The fundamental principle of weight loss is creating an energy deficit. This means that you are consuming fewer calories than your body is using. Calories are a measure of energy, and if you consume more energy than your body needs, it stores that energy as fat. To lose weight, you need to create a calorie deficit. You can do this by reducing your calorie intake or increasing your energy expenditure. However, it's essential to strike a balance to avoid consuming too few calories, which can lead to health risks like malnutrition.

Chapter 2: Macronutrients and Weight Loss
Macronutrients include carbohydrates, fats, and proteins. They provide different amounts of energy to the body, with fats providing the most calories per gram. Reducing calorie intake is a key step in achieving weight loss, but it's not enough. The quality of the foods you eat is also crucial. For example, consuming nutrient-dense foods can help you feel full and satisfied on fewer calories. Additionally, foods rich in protein can help repair damaged muscle tissues, which is important during weight loss.

Chapter 3: The Role of Exercise in Weight Loss
Exercise is a crucial component of weight loss. It can help you burn calories, increase your energy expenditure, and improve body composition. Physical activity also offers other health benefits, such as reducing the risk of chronic diseases. The type and intensity of exercise you choose are essential factors in weight loss. High-intensity interval training and resistance training can help you burn more calories during and after exercise, increasing your resting metabolic rate. Exercise for Weight Loss

Chapter 4: Metabolism and Weight Loss
Metabolism refers to the chemical processes that occur in the body to maintain life. Your metabolism determines how many calories your body burns at rest. Many factors influence your metabolism, including genetics, age, body size, and hormone levels. There are ways to increase your metabolism, such as building muscle mass, consuming lean protein, and getting enough sleep. However, boosting your metabolism isn't a silver bullet for weight loss. Creating an energy deficit with various lifestyle modifications is the best approach.

Chapter 6: Hormones and Weight Loss
Hormones play a vital role in weight regulation. Hormones like insulin, leptin, and ghrelin regulate appetite and energy expenditure. Changes in your hormone levels can influence your metabolism and make it challenging to lose weight. Some lifestyle modifications can help regulate hormone levels, such as reducing stress, getting enough sleep, and consuming fiber-rich foods. Understanding the role of hormones in weight loss can help you make more informed lifestyle choices.
